Hewlett-Packard set up a facility in Tailand to produce Hewlett-Packard designed printer called Apollo. A certain Apple II publication and publisher stated that the price would be about $79.00 US. That was wrong. The "Rite-Aid" stores advertized on 8/29/99 that the Apollo P-1200 color inkjet printer was on sale at $49.99 US. That is a amazing price for a a new color inkjet Printer by Hewlett-Packard for use with the IIgs. And, it has a full guarantee from HP and color. Upon calling several of the Rite-Aid stores locally to get varification on the price it should be noted that the actual price the Apollo P-1200 sells for from them is $89.95. After you purchase it you can send in a rebate form for a $50 rebate from Hewlett-Packard which in effect gives you the Apollo P-1200 color inkjet printer for under $40 actually. Also please note that nation-wide, some of the Rite-Aid stores have it in stock for retail sales while others are out of stock currently due the the large number of sales and customer demand for this printer. Also note that the Apollo P-1200 inkjet Printer by Hewlett-Packard is the exact same printer as the DeskJet 420c and so is the Barbie printer. by the way, the DJ 420c, the Apollo-1200 and the Barbie printer are all fully IIgs compatible. So, in the final review of the above information related it seems you can actually get the Apollo P-1200 color inkjet printer from Rite-Aid stores with your final cost being under $40, after rebate.
